FRIDAY: EPA, Oklahoma City to Announce $300,000 Brownfields Grant

 

(DALLAS – May 26, 2021) The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) and the city of Oklahoma City will discuss $300,000 in grant money provided by EPA’s Brownfields Program for assessing abandoned or contaminated properties (known as brownfields).
